Aims & Scope
Presenting research that bears on important conceptual issues in developmental psychologists, Developmental Review: Perspectives in Behavior and Cognition provides child and developmental, child clinical psychologists with authoritative articles that reflect current thinking and cover significant scientific developments.
The journal emphasizes human developmental processes and gives particular attention to research that is relevant to developmental psychology.
Research has fundamental implications for the fields of pediatrics, psychiatry, and neuroscience, and increases the understanding of socialization processes.
